5. Make a spider spray
In a spray bottle, combine white vinegar with water, shake it up, and then spray any areas where spiders are known to congregate around your home. It’s as simple as that! Unfortunately, you have to apply this spray daily for it to work.
4. Get a cat
Many cats are hard-wired to chase and pounce on anything that moves, including spiders. However, you could end up with a cat-like ours that won’t have anything to do with insects or spiders. You also have to be cautious about your pets if you’re dealing with poisonous spiders that could bite and harm them.
3. Use 20 Mule Team Borax
Borax (sodium tetraborate decahydrate) is a powder that is usually used to control cockroaches or ants. It is effective when sprinkled in out-of-the-way places where spiders and insects hide. We prefer to sprinkle it in the cracks between the window and the storm or screen window. It can be washed away when it rains though and it’s more effective at getting rid of the insects that spiders eat than actually killing the spiders themselves.
2. Check your house for entry points
For spiders to be inside your home, they have to find a way in first. Look for any cracks, crevices, or openings where spiders could squeeze through into your home. Then grab your caulking gun and get to work sealing up all those entry points.
1. Keep your house clean
Spiders love clutter and will make a home behind boxes and other things that are just sitting around your house. Dust, sweep and vacuum at least once a week, making sure to actually get in the corners, behind furniture and other items. Remove cobwebs as soon as you see them. Don’t leave food or crumbs about because that invites insects and spiders eat insects.
